What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in AI transportation roles?

Professionals in AI transportation often encounter challenges such as integrating advanced AI solutions with legacy transportation systems, ensuring data quality for effective machine learning models, and addressing safety and regulatory requirements. Collaborating with multidisciplinary teams—including engineers, data scientists, and city planners—is crucial for developing practical and scalable solutions. Additionally, adapting quickly to evolving technologies and industry standards is essential for success and career growth in this dynamic field.

What is AI Transportation?

AI Transportation refers to the use of artificial intelligence technologies to improve and automate various aspects of transportation systems. This includes self-driving vehicles, intelligent traffic management, route optimization, predictive maintenance, and smart logistics. AI helps increase safety, efficiency, and sustainability in transportation by analyzing large amounts of data and making real-time decisions. The field is rapidly evolving and is being adopted by public transit systems, freight companies, and private vehicle manufacturers worldwide.
